Broccoli Salad

  • Difficulty: easy
  • Rating: ★★★★★SERVES: 1-4<br /> TIME: 30 minutes + 3 hours minimum refrigeration
  • Print

Ingredients

½ cup mayonnaise
¼ cup of sugar
2 Tablespoons cider vinegar
3 bunches of broccoli, rinsed and cut into small florets
¼ cup purple onion, finely chopped
1 lb. bacon, fried and crumbled
½ cup yellow raisins
½ cup sunflower seeds

Directions


1. Combine mayonnaise, sugar, and cider vinegar in a medium-sized bowl.
2. Add the broccoli, onion, bacon, raisins, and sunflower seeds and mix well.
3. Refrigerate 3 hours or overnight.
